Yvette Farkas

About Yvette Farkas

Yvette Farkas is an award-winning, multi-genre author and transformative storyteller whose work bridges raw urban culture, urgent health realities, and heart-centered children's mindfulness. Her acclaimed titles include the groundbreaking Toronto Graffiti: The Human Behind the Wall (a 500+ page anthology of unprecedented artist interviews and 1,000+ photos), the essential Toxic Mold: Essential Health Solutions guide, and the Readers' Favorite award-winning Ethan and the Seven Chakras series—an eight-part adventure series that empowers kids aged 7+ to master emotional intelligence, energy healing, and personal growth through captivating, heart-focused stories.

Her books have earned national recognition—featured by The Globe and Mail and CBC Radio, referenced by the City of Toronto, sold at the Art Gallery of Ontario, and preserved in the permanent collections of the National Library of Canada.

As founder of Singing Soul Books, Yvette empowers aspiring authors to self-publish with clarity, confidence, and joy, connecting readers worldwide to uplifting, meaningful narratives. She created the acclaimed online course From Manuscript to Market, a step-by-step roadmap that has guides first-time authors to successfully launch their books.

Co-founder of Booyah Books, she crafts enchanting children's stories, music, and meditations—such as Loved Like Lilly (exploring love languages) and its companion album—that nurture positive mindsets, emotional resilience, and joyful self-discovery in young hearts.

With over 25 years as a holistic health consultant and bio-resonance expert—plus 30 years of martial arts training—Yvette weaves ancient healing wisdom, mindset mastery, and modern science to guide individuals back to vibrant health, authentic purpose, and heart alignment. She has inspired and elevated international audiences as a featured speaker at MindValley University, the Future You Summit in the UAE (Dubai), and events across Canada and Hungary, sharing powerful insights on healing, resilience, and living aligned with one's deepest vision.
